It certainly is no new trend or the latest invention of a buzzworthy stylist, yet art placed on the floor has some sophisticated appeal to it that rarely goes unnoticed. Like the eclectic Parisian apartment of an art collector crammed with statement pieces or an artist's loft with new produces piled daily on the dusty floors and walls, having art pieces leaning on the wall create an ambiance without much effort even to the humblest of abodes. And there is absolutely no effort to copy this styling tip at home. A large scale print or a cluster of smaller ones can be placed on literally any spot in the house, even behind large furnitures like sofas and consoles and with no need of hammers and nasty holes on the wall whatsoever.
